Land Grading in Houston, TX
Land grading services involve shaping and leveling the soil on a property to ensure proper drainage and a stable foundation. This process is commonly used for new construction projects, landscape improvements, or to correct existing issues such as uneven terrain, standing water, or erosion problems. Homeowners often request land grading to prepare a yard for landscaping, build a driveway, or prevent water from pooling around the foundation. Understanding the current topography and the desired outcome can help property owners determine if land grading is a suitable solution for their needs.
Before requesting land grading services, property owners should consider the existing slope, soil type, and drainage patterns of their land. It’s important to identify areas prone to water accumulation or erosion and to clarify the intended use of the space afterward. Proper planning ensures that the grading work effectively directs water away from structures and creates a safe, stable surface for future landscaping or construction projects. Clear communication about goals and site conditions can help achieve the desired results efficiently.

Land Grading Questions
What is land grading? Land grading involves shaping the soil surface to improve drainage, prevent erosion, and prepare the site for construction or landscaping projects.
Why is land grading important? Proper grading helps direct water away from structures, reduces flooding risks, and creates a stable foundation for building or landscaping.
What types of projects typically require land grading? Common projects include installing new lawns, building patios, preparing for foundations, or improving drainage around existing properties.
How does land grading affect property value? Well-executed grading can enhance the property's appearance, prevent water damage, and support landscaping, all contributing to increased value.
